Sal Kahn makes complex subjects simple in his videos.  And he's Bill Gates favorite teacher.  His site of over 2,400 free videos is partially sponsored by the Gates Foundation.





AND, if you're a teacher or parent, you can direct how your children or students use the site and see what they are completing.  The site also includes interactive exercises.

Thousands of Old-Tyme Radio Shows

Before televisions appeared in every household in the US, children like Ralphie were huddled around radios to listen to their favorite programs. Long ago those programs stopped being broadcast, but you can still listen to them. The Old Time Radio Network is an online collection of more than 12,000 old radio shows. The catalog is organized alphabetically by program title. Next to each program title you'll find the number of episodes available online.
